根據 Stratistics MRC 的數據,全球零信任安全市場預計在 2024 年達到 397 億美元,到 2030 年將達到 1,025 億美元,預測期內的複合年成長率為 17.1%。零信任安全性是一種網路安全模型,無論在網路內或網路外,預設情況下都不能信任任何使用者、裝置或系統。在授予任何資源的存取權限之前,必須不斷檢驗身分、進入許可權和安全狀態。這種方法透過實施嚴格的存取控制、監控和網路分段來最大限度地降低安全漏洞的風險。零信任秉承「永不信任,始終檢驗」的原則來保護敏感資料和系統。

根據微軟 2023 年的報告,具有 MFA 的帳戶被洩露的可能性比僅依賴密碼的帳戶低 99.9%。

According to Stratistics MRC, the Global Zero Trust Security Market is accounted for $39.7 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ach $102.5 billion by 2030 growing at a CAGR of 17.1% during the forecast period. Zero Trust Security is a cybersecurity model that assumes no user, device, or system-whether inside or outside the network-can be trusted by default. It requires continuous verification of identity, access rights, and security status before granting access to any resource. This approach minimizes the risk of security breaches by enforcing strict access controls, monitoring, and segmenting the network. Zero Trust focuses on the principle of "never trust, always verify" to protect sensitive data and systems.

According to a Microsoft report from 2023, accounts with MFA are 99.9% less likely of getting compromised than those depending only on passwords.

Market Dynamics:

Driver:

Growing remote work trends

Zero Trust Security, which assumes no trust by default, ensures continuous verification and strict access controls for all users, regardless of their location. This paradigm is crucial as businesses seek to safeguard sensitive data from cyber threats and unauthorized access. As remote workforces expand, the need for solutions that authenticate users, devices, and networks before granting access becomes more pressing. Furthermore, the rise in cloud computing, which often supports remote work, aligns with the Zero Trust model's focus on protecting cloud infrastructure. Ultimately, these factors are propelling the growth of the Zero Trust Security market, as organizations adapt to evolving security needs in a distributed work environment.

Covid-19 Impact

The COVID-19 pandemic significantly accelerated the adoption of Zero Trust Security as businesses shifted to remote work models. With increased cybersecurity threats and vulnerabilities due to the rapid transition, organizations prioritized securing networks with a Zero Trust approach. The market saw a surge in demand for solutions that offer continuous authentication and access control, ensuring only authorized users and devices can access sensitive data. The shift to cloud-based services further boosted the market, as traditional security models became inadequate for decentralized operations.

Key Developments:

In December 2024, Cisco partnered with AppOmni to enhance SaaS security by integrating AppOmni's Zero Trust Posture Management (ZTPM) solution with Cisco's Security Service Edge (SSE). This collaboration aims to provide comprehensive zero trust principles at the application layer for SaaS applications, improving visibility and security across complex installations.

In November 2024, Cisco continues to advance its Zero Trust offerings by integrating various solutions such as Duo Security, Identity Services Engine (ISE), and Secure Workload into a cohesive framework. These solutions are designed to enforce strict access controls based on user identity and context, essential for maintaining security in a hybrid work environment.
